Start Tracking Your Engagement Metrics Precisely

My first move was implementing a detailed tracking system for every interaction, such as clicks, calls, and photo views. I used tools like Google My Business Insights combined with UTM parameters to monitor traffic sources. Initially, this was a mess—data was scattered and comparisons were tough. But by creating a simple spreadsheet and setting weekly review points, I could identify patterns indicating what truly boosted engagement.
For example, I noticed increased profile visits after I added new photos and responded promptly to reviews. Regularly auditing this data helped me fine-tune my actions, focusing on high-impact signals like messaging response times and photo updates. This approach is essential: without precise measurement, you’re flying blind in the local SEO maze.

Enhance Your Profile to Incentivize Interaction

Keep Your Info Up-to-Date

Next, I audited my profile, ensuring business hours, services, and descriptions reflected the current state. Outdated info can discourage potential customers, reducing interactions. Think of your profile as a shop window—if it’s dusty or half-open, passersby will walk past.

Use Rich Media Strategically

Photos and videos are your virtual handshake. I replaced old photos with fresh, high-quality images showcasing new offerings, and uploaded spatial videos demonstrating my service area, which vastly increased views and engagement. I learned that vivid visuals build trust and prompt actions—more clicks, calls, and visits. To optimize further, I aligned captions with relevant keywords without overstuffing, aiding Google’s semantic algorithms.

Implement Proven Interaction Boost Techniques

To accelerate engagement, I employed methods like prompt response templates for reviews and inquiries—timely responses encourage more customers to interact. Also, I encouraged satisfied clients to leave reviews by simple follow-up messages. This created a feedback loop: higher reviews boost trust, which increases clicks, leading to more reviews and interactions—a cycle that Google rewards with higher rankings.

To leverage these signals effectively, consider using tools that automate review requests and alert you to new interactions. Remember, consistency matters; sporadic efforts yield minimal results. The key is regular, strategic action across all touchpoints.

Leverage Local Authority Building

Building citations on reputable local directories and earning backlinks from local partners subtly enhances your profile’s authority. I reached out to local bloggers and business associations for partnerships, which led to backlinks and mentions. These signals tell Google your business is a trusted local entity, boosting your visibility in Maps. Regularly monitoring this off-page authority growth keeps your profile competitive against local competitors.

How do I maintain my local SEO momentum over time?

Consistency is the secret sauce when it comes to sustaining your Google Maps performance. Relying solely on initial optimizations won’t cut it in 2026; you need a structured approach using the right tools and techniques. I’ve personally found that integrating advanced tracking and automation tools streamlines the process and helps me stay ahead of emerging local search trends.
One tool I highly recommend is Whitespark’s Local Citation Finder. It allows me to identify new citation opportunities and monitor existing ones, ensuring my business stays authoritative in local directories. Additionally, Google Tag Manager helps me deploy and update tracking pixels across various platforms without needing to constantly edit code—a major time-saver for maintaining accurate interaction data.
Beyond standalone tools, leveraging comprehensive dashboards like Google Data Studio enables me to visualize engagement metrics and spot downward trends or gaps early. Regularly reviewing these insights empowers me to pivot strategies swiftly, whether that’s optimizing new content signals or improving customer interaction tactics.
